A live bamboo crib wall is a three-dimensional structure created from untreated bamboos, fill material and live cuttings. WebMar 24, 2024 · Bamboo culms can attain heights ranging from 10 to 15 cm (about 4 to 6 inches) in the smallest species to more than 40 metres (about 130 feet) in the largest. WebVertical vegetative axis of the bamboo plant. Size, color and shape of the culm can be a defining way to classify or exclude many species of bamboo during the identification process. Sulcus Groove Flat scar left behind from limb formation during the growth process. It is not evident in all genus but very pronounced in genus like Phyllostachys.
